Understanding the core polymer matrix is essential when selecting waterproof barriers. The table below details key physical performance benchmarks across our three core manufacturing lines:
| Polymer Parameter | PE Coated Fabric (HDPE/LDPE) | PP Woven Tarpaulin | PVC Coated Membrane (Polyester Mesh) |
|---|---|---|---|
| Weight Range (GSM) | 60 g/m² – 300 g/m² | 70 g/m² – 280 g/m² | 400 g/m² – 900 g/m² |
| Tensile Strength (Warp/Weft) | 700 N / 900 N per 50mm | 850 N / 1050 N per 50mm | 2200 N / 2500 N per 50mm |
| Hydrostatic Pressure Resistance | > 50 kPa (Standard) | > 40 kPa | > 150 kPa (High Pressure) |
| Flexibility at Low Temp (-30°C) | Excellent (No cracking) | Moderate | Requires Cold-Flex Additives |
| UV Degradation Resistance | 3%–5% UV Masterbatch (3–5 Yrs) | 2%–4% UV Masterbatch | Inherent UV Stability (5–10 Yrs) |
| Primary Market Applications | General Covers, Agribusiness, Scaffolding | Heavy Freight, Weed Barrier, Layflat Hose | Truck Side Curtains, Tents, Membranes |
Unprotected bulk grain stockpiles and hay bales suffer significant spoilage due to condensation buildup and moisture migration. Star Tarpaulins engineers dual-color thermal-reflective sheets (e.g., Silver/Black or Green/Silver). The outer silver layer reflects infrared solar radiation—lowering sub-tarp storage temperatures by 10°C to 15°C—while the inner high-density black layer blocks photosynthetically active light to prevent mold and bacterial spore proliferation.
Commercial road transport demands tarpaulins that withstand dynamic wind loads, continuous highway vibration, and mechanical abrasion. Our heavy-duty PE and PVC panelling incorporates reinforced poly-rope hems, heat-welded seams, and anti-rust brass eyelets every 50 cm. These specs prevent wind-whipping tearing and maintain structural integrity across coast-to-coast shipping routes.
